Steve Mansfield has been working as a professional musician since 1990. He has performed all over the northeastern United States, and especially in the New York City area. Steve has performed at numerous music festivals and toured Europe. His playing encompasses a wide range of musical styles including funk, rock, blues, Afro-Cuban, Caribbean, big band, small group jazz, and world music.
Steve’s educational background includes a Bachelor of Music in jazz performance from New York University, studies at The Drummer Collective NYC, as well as personal instruction from some of the world’s finest instructors including: John Riley, Adam Nussbaum, Kim Plainfield, Frankie Malabe Warren Odze, Arthur Lipner, Pete Abbott, Jim Mola, Sherrie Miracle, Bill Cerulli, and bassist Mike Richmond.

Steve has been teaching music since 1988. His students have received college scholarships, won regional competitions, and ranked high in national competition. Currently, he is teaching both private and group lessons. He performs regularly with numerous groups, and freelances in the New York metro area.
In 2001 Cherry Lane published Steve’s book titled 1001 Drum Grooves: The Complete Resource for Every Drummer. The book covers a wide range of playing styles and has sold tens of thousands of copies worldwide.
